Deepsheet Use cases
Use Cases:
1. **Business Analysis:** Deepsheet can be used to analyze sales data, customer information, or any other data collected by a business. Users can ask questions like “What were our best-selling products last month?” or “How much revenue did we generate in the last quarter?”
2. **Research:** Researchers can use Deepsheet to explore and understand datasets without needing to write complex code or use specialized software. They can ask questions about survey results, experiment data, or any research findings.
3. **Financial Planning:** Deepsheet can help individuals manage their personal finances better. By importing bank statements, users can ask questions like “How much did I spend on groceries last year?” or “What’s my average monthly income?”
4. **Content Creation:** Content creators can analyze audience engagement data from various platforms using Deepsheet. It can assist in making data-driven decisions for content strategies.
5. **Education:** Deepsheet can be a valuable tool for students and educators to learn data analysis and statistics in a more approachable way.

Deepsheet Cons
- Dependency on AI: Using Deepsheet means relying on artificial intelligence to interpret and analyze your data. If the AI makes errors or misinterprets the data, it can lead to incorrect conclusions and decisions.
- Limitations in Unstructured Data: Deepsheet may struggle to handle unstructured data, such as text documents or images. It is primarily designed to work with structured data in spreadsheet-like formats.
- Privacy Concerns: Importing personal or sensitive data into Deepsheet means entrusting it to a third-party AI tool. There could be potential privacy issues if the data falls into the wrong hands or if the tool mishandles it.
- Limited Customization Options: While Deepsheet provides a user-friendly interface, it may lack customization options for users with more specific or advanced data analysis needs. It may not allow advanced statistical analysis or custom algorithms.
- Lack of Contextual Understanding: Although Deepsheet can understand English queries, it may lack the ability to comprehend the context completely. This can lead to ambiguous or incorrect answers when dealing with complex or multifaceted questions.
- Learning Curve: While Deepsheet aims to be user-friendly, newcomers may still find it challenging to learn and navigate the tool effectively. The initial learning curve may require time and effort to overcome.
- Dependency on Internet Connection: Deepsheet is a web-based tool, meaning it requires a stable internet connection to function. Without an internet connection, users cannot access or analyze their data.
- Subscription Cost: While Deepsheet may offer a free trial or basic features, using the tool extensively or accessing its advanced functionality may require a subscription or payment. This cost can become a barrier for some users.

FAQs
1. Can Deepsheet analyze data stored in different file formats?
Yes, Deepsheet can work with data stored in formats like spreadsheets, CSV files, and JSON.
2. How does Deepsheet understand and analyze data?
Deepsheet uses AI algorithms to interpret and process data. It understands natural language queries and provides smart answers based on the data you input.
3. Is programming knowledge required to use Deepsheet?
No, programming knowledge is not required. Deepsheet is designed to be user-friendly and accessible, allowing anyone to analyze data without writing complex code.
4. Can I import my own datasets into Deepsheet?
Yes, you can import your own datasets into Deepsheet. It allows you to work with your own data, making it more versatile for various use cases.
5. Are there any limitations to the amount of data Deepsheet can handle?
Deepsheet can handle large datasets, but the actual performance may depend on the hardware and resources available on your system.
6. Can Deepsheet perform advanced calculations or data manipulations?
Yes, Deepsheet has the capability to perform advanced calculations and data manipulations. It even allows you to run Python scripts within the interface for more complex tasks.
7. How can I collaborate with others using Deepsheet?
Deepsheet allows you to save and share your insights with others. You can collaborate on projects or present your findings to a team by sharing the analyzed data and insights generated.
